On Mar 27, 2006, at 7:11 PM, Kenneth Shelton wrote:
We routinely scan our entire class B subnet monthly. As we are a University, we are very compartmentalized and the scans are, therefore, broken up into chunks. We have run into an issue that the nessus client (ran from a seperate machine as the nessus daemon) receives a connection termination from the nessus daemon in the middle of most of the larger scans. Last month I tracked down a specific scan that was giving us a problem and isolated the problem to one class C which, when scanned even by itself would still cause a crash the majority of the time, but it did actually complete the scan once. Now about 5-7 blocks larger blocks are crashing in the middle of the scans and the issue has us pooling our hair out.
Here are the arguments being passed to the client:
